Oracle Database Error ACFS-01160: Accelerator Volume Too Small

📦 Oracle Database
📋

Description

This error indicates that an Oracle ACFS accelerator volume has been configured with insufficient capacity. It typically occurs during the creation, configuration, or modification of an ACFS file system when the specified accelerator volume does not meet the minimum size requirements for the operation.
💬

Error Message

The specified accelerator volume was smaller than the number string required for this file system.
🔍

Known Causes

3 known causes
⚠️
Insufficient Volume Capacity
The accelerator volume was provisioned with a size that is less than the minimum required by the ACFS file system for its operational needs.
⚠️
Incorrect Configuration Parameters
ACFS file system parameters or features were configured in a way that implicitly demands a larger accelerator volume than was provided.
⚠️
Data Entry Error
A typographical error or miscalculation occurred when specifying the accelerator volume size during setup or modification.
